DMET-Analyzer (RRID:SCR_002030) | DMET-Analyzer | software resource | Software tool for the automatic association analysis among the variation of the patient genomes and the clinical conditions of patients, i.e. the different response to drugs. The system allows: (i) to automatize the workflow of analysis of DMET (drug metabolism enzymes and transporters)-SNP (Single Nucleotide Polymorphism) data avoiding the use of multiple tools; (ii) the automatic annotation of DMET-SNP data and the search in existing databases of SNPs (e.g. dbSNP), (iii) the association of SNP with pathway through the search in PharmaKGB, a major knowledge base for pharmacogenomic studies. It has a simple graphical user interface that allows users (doctors/biologists) to upload and analyze DMET files produced by Affymetrix DMET-Console in an interactive way. | drug, metabolism, enzyme, transporter, affymetrix, variation, genome, clinical, affymetrix dmet, single nucleotide polymorphism, annotation, analysis, pharmacogenomic, pathway |

flowMap (RRID:SCR_002269) | software resource | Software package that quantifies the similarity of cell populations across multiple flow cytometry samples using a nonparametric multivariate statistical test. The algorithm allows the users to specify a reference sample for comparison or to construct a reference sample from the available data. The output of the algorithm is a set of text files where the cell population labels are replaced by a metaset of population labels, generated from the matching process. | software package, mac os x, unix/linux, windows, r, flow cytometry, multiple comparison |

SNAP - SNP Annotation and Proxy Search (RRID:SCR_002127) | SNAP | production service resource, software resource, data analysis service, software application, analysis service resource, service resource | A computer program and web-based service for the rapid retrieval of linkage disequilibrium proxy single nucleotide polymorphism (SNP) results given input of one or more query SNPs and based on empirical observations from the International HapMap Project and the 1000 Genomes Project. A series of filters allow users to optionally retrieve results that are limited to specific combinations of genotyping platforms, above specified pairwise r2 thresholds, or up to a maximum distance between query and proxy SNPs. SNAP can also generate linkage disequilibrium plots | gene, genetic, genomic, r, oracle, single nucleotide polymorphism, linkage disequilibrium, genotypeing array, physical distance, membership, proxy, plot |

pfSNP (RRID:SCR_002167) | pfSNP | data or information resource, database, service resource, storage service resource, data repository | Search engine integrating various bio-informatic resources and algorithims to produce a one-stop resource for biologists to identify potentially functional SNPs. It caters to different groups of scientists interested in SNPs including those working in the following areas: * Whole-genome association studies * Gene-based association studies * Designing experiments to address the functionality of specific SNPs * Determining potentially functionally significant SNPs that are in LD with non-pfSNPs of interest. Users may add published SNP functions. | single nucleotide polymorphism, function, association study, gene, genome |
